Output 8d0c63b302fb2a56eacef46ebc7f1bd86734b7cfb68d8970d9bb1b41d0f70db2:0

value
2660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c88eb0a2f1a281077d590d9000082aa7389d58e OP_EQUAL
address
37D6VHsGnChXLYV9JYJ4em7iXeAHRFjwiT
transaction
8d0c63b302fb2a56eacef46ebc7f1bd86734b7cfb68d8970d9bb1b41d0f70db2
spent
true